Concrete mudjacking services involve lifting and leveling uneven or sunken concrete slabs by injecting a specialized mixture beneath the surface. This process typically uses a slurry made of cement, sand, and water, which is pumped into the voids under the concrete to raise it back to its original position. The technique is a cost-effective alternative to replacing entire slabs, providing a quick solution to restore the appearance and functionality of driveways, sidewalks, patios, and other flat surfaces.

One of the primary issues mudjacking addresses is uneven or settling concrete that can create tripping hazards or make outdoor spaces look neglected. Over time, soil erosion, shifting ground, or poor initial installation can cause concrete slabs to sink or crack. Mudjacking helps stabilize these surfaces, preventing further deterioration and reducing the risk of accidents. It can also improve drainage by leveling surfaces, which helps prevent water pooling and potential damage to surrounding structures.

Discover typical Concrete Mudjacking project ranges for Elma, WA.

Cost Range - Concrete mudjacking services typically cost between $500 and $1,500 per slab. Larger or more complex projects may reach up to $2,500, depending on size and location.

Factors Influencing Price - Prices vary based on the size of the area to be lifted and the extent of the underlying damage. For example, a small driveway may cost around $600, while a large patio could be closer to $2,000.

Average Cost per Square Foot - The average cost for mudjacking is approximately $3 to $6 per square foot. Smaller repairs tend to be at the lower end of this range, with larger projects at the higher end.

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include surface repairs or sealing after lifting, which can add a few hundred dollars to the total. It’s advisable to get estimates from local service providers for accurate pricing.

What is concrete mudjacking? Concrete mudjacking is a process that involves injecting a mixture of soil, cement, and water beneath a settled or uneven concrete slab to lift and level it.

How long does mudjacking typically last? The longevity of mudjacking depends on factors like soil conditions and slab usage, but many repairs can last several years when performed by experienced local service providers.

Is mudjacking suitable for all types of concrete surfaces? Mudjacking is generally suitable for driveways, sidewalks, and patios, but a local contractor can assess whether it's appropriate for specific concrete slabs.

Are there any preparations needed before mudjacking? Preparation usually involves cleaning the surface and ensuring proper access, with specific requirements provided by the local pros during consultation.

Can mudjacking be combined with other repair methods? Yes, local service providers often recommend combining mudjacking with other repairs or surface treatments to enhance durability and appearance.
